The Template list includes user-defined templates (schemes) of ground beams and their reinforcement. After defining the ground beam geometry and reinforcement, it is possible to save these settings by specifying a name in the Template field and clicking the Save button (Note: a template is saved in a selected group and a selected project). After defining the ground beam reinforcement and selecting the name of a saved template (in a selected project and a selected group), all parameters in the dialog are set exactly as they are defined in the template.

To open a template saved in a selected project and a selected group, click Load. To delete a selected template assigned to a selected project and a selected group, click Delete.

Templates saved in the macros for formworks of structure elements are available and can be loaded to the corresponding reinforcement macros. Once such a template is loaded, the Geometrytab sets parameters of the structure element geometry saved in the template.
